Web252 rows · Population density (people per km 2) by country in 2024 This is a list of … WebSep 8, 2024 · Population density is most effective in small-scale places—cities or neighborhoods —where people are evenly distributed. Whereas at a larger scale , such as the state , region , or province level, population density could vary widely as it includes a mix of urban , suburban , and rural places.

WebMay 31, 2024 · Answer: density independent Explanation: In Ecology, density independent factors are limiting factors that do not depend on the size of a population to affect such population. Examples of density independent limiting factors are fire outbreak, earthquake and other natural disasters. on the spot poems https://ptjobsglobal.com

WebMar 29, 2024 · The population density equation is: Dp =N /A D p = N / A In this formula, Dp is the density of the population, N is the number of individuals in the population, and A is the area.
